![]() I'll put some thought into putting another one together... Problem becomes transport - if you're not planning to actually drive out with a big truck, it's not very economical to ship...
Cost for LTL freight is pretty extreme right now, mostly on the fuel surcharge (and you've got to remember, a skid (24 pails) weighs 1200lbs). Roughly translates into almost 10$/pail just in freight. I'll give it some further thought, and see if there might be some cheaper LTL carriers around. Andy |
